Every conversion is just the difference in UTC offsets
Every zone is defined by how far it is ahead of or behind UTC. To move a time from one zone to another, subtract the source offset and add the target offset. A location further east has the larger offset and the later clock. The only thing that changes an offset during the year is daylight saving.
UTC offsets for major cities
| City | Zone | Standard | Daylight |
|---|---|---|---|
| Los Angeles | PT | UTC−8 | UTC−7 |
| New York / Toronto | ET | UTC−5 | UTC−4 |
| London | GMT / BST | UTC+0 | UTC+1 |
| Paris / Berlin | CET | UTC+1 | UTC+2 |
| Mumbai (India) | IST | UTC+5:30 | — |
| Kathmandu (Nepal) | NST | UTC+5:45 | — |
| Tokyo | JST | UTC+9 | — |
| Adelaide (S. Australia) | ACST | UTC+9:30 | UTC+10:30 |
| Sydney | AET | UTC+10 | UTC+11 |
Zones like India, Nepal and Japan stay on one offset all year. The world runs from UTC−12 to UTC+14, so the widest gap between two clocks is 26 hours.
The two things that catch people out
- Daylight saving shifts the offset. When a zone is on summer time its clock jumps an hour, so New York moves from UTC-5 to UTC-4. Use the offset that applies on the actual date, not the standard one.
- Hemispheres and start dates don't line up. The US, Europe and Australia switch on different weekends, and the southern hemisphere runs summer time during the northern winter. For a week or two each spring and autumn the usual gap between two cities is off by an hour.
- Some countries dropped daylight saving. Most of Mexico, Brazil, Russia and Turkey now hold a fixed offset year-round, so their gap to Europe or the US moves twice a year even though their own clock never changes.

How do I convert a time between two zones?
Take the difference of their UTC offsets and add it to the source time. If a city is at UTC-5 and you want UTC+1, the target is 6 hours ahead (1 minus -5). Going east adds hours, going west subtracts them.
Is UTC the same as GMT?
For everyday purposes, yes. Both sit on the Greenwich meridian at zero offset. UTC is the modern atomic-clock standard used by computers and aviation; GMT is the older civil term. The clock reading is the same.
Why do some countries use a 30 or 45 minute offset?
A handful of places sit between whole-hour meridians and chose a fractional offset to match local solar noon more closely. India is UTC+5:30, Nepal UTC+5:45, and parts of Australia run UTC+9:30.
